American actress Norma Martin is on holiday in Paris. Tired of annoying fans, she decides to go with her friend Gloria Marshall to the south of France. By fateful coincidence, Larry Charters, an incredibly popular composer, and his friend - he is Gloria's fiancé - Bob Talmadge are on the same train with them. Larry also hides from fans, and during the journey he and Bob exchange passports for purposes of secrecy. At one stop, Norma and Bob are behind the train. There is no hotel in the small town
